Black: superstitions, symbolism, and decorating trends
In the collective imagination, black is associated with mourning, sadness, fear, and even death.
However, in the world of interior decoration and design, black is synonymous with modernity, chic, and elegance.
Considered a "non-color" by artists, or an absence of light by scientists, interior designers and architects, however, do not hesitate to use it either sparingly or in an all-black look.
This is notably because black highlights subtle details and lines like no other color.
It is also very elegant to use black on imposing pieces, such as curtains or a piece of furniture, to create contrast.
The pinnacle of creativity: painting woodwork, doors, and even a ceiling to accentuate the architecture of a place.

Wrongly considered an aggressive or sad color, black actually creates a calming, enveloping, and deep atmosphere.
It is also appreciated for its purity and the sobriety it exudes.
More subtle than it seems, there are a plethora of shades and hues of black, ranging from anthracite to ebony, navy blue, and other deep greens.
Its many shades also vary depending on its density, material, and surface.
Whatever shade of black you choose, adopting black in your interior decor will be a great idea to add depth, define spaces, create contrast, dynamism, and visual harmony.

What color goes well with black? Perfect associations and shades
Blue, pink, yellow, gray… generally, black goes with all colors and creates harmonious associations.
A bold shade, it always creates an interesting contrast that doesn't lack character, sophistication, and elegance.
The king of association when thinking of black is the famous "black & white," of course!
A classic and timeless duo, perfect for creating crisp graphic lines, and one that has never lost its place in decoration catalogs.
Less seen, but just as effective, the association of deep forest green with black creates a luxurious marriage that enhances both shades.
More modern and unexpected, the combination of black and mustard yellow.
Two very trendy shades in recent years, which will bring sunshine and character into your interior, especially if you're afraid of lacking light when using black.

As for materials, it's simple, everything goes with it!
Raw concrete, ceramic, metal, and even all wood species, from the lightest to the darkest, harmonize with black very easily.
Not only does it go with all materials, but it can even be the main support, such as black zellige tiles, wrought iron, burnt wood, or black marble.
In short, black is not just for walls; it invests every nook and cranny, to our great delight.

Black living room: creating a chic and elegant atmosphere
The living room is undoubtedly the room best suited for the generous use of the color black in decoration.
It can be used in small touches on accessories or more generously on an entire wall to create an ambiance.
The possibilities are numerous, and its use can be very helpful in structuring and creating overall harmony in the room.
A large black rug contrasted with a light floor will define the space, while an accumulation of graphic posters will add rhythm to the walls and structure the decor.
To visually separate a kitchen from a living room and create a visual contrast, a black glass partition beautifully divides the spaces.

Black kitchen: a chic decoration with the right associations
Black in a kitchen is a clear choice for modern and chic decoration!
A totally black kitchen is undoubtedly the epitome of chic and elegance, but if the total look scares you, it's possible to approach it gradually.
Why not choose to only use black on your kitchen fronts, or just on the appliances?
The must-have trend in recent years has been to choose two different fronts, one for the upper cabinets and another for the lower cabinets.
The backsplash, accessories, or even the countertop can also be black to create contrast with the rest of the decor.
Ultimately, adopting a black kitchen is very easy.

As for associations in a kitchen, white marble, various shades of granite, or natural wood pair very well with black.
It's easy to imagine a black kitchen enhanced by a natural wood or white marble countertop; each element will then stand out and create a beautiful result thanks to the contrast.
Whether you use one of these materials on the countertop and/or as a backsplash, it will break up the overly black effect and provide an interesting contrast.
If you are lucky enough to have a brick or stone wall, choosing a black kitchen will yield stunning results.

Black bathroom: the perfect combination for a luxury space
A black bathroom is an excellent choice for a luxurious and modern decor, and you only need to look at the examples below to be convinced.
On tiles, grout, floor, furniture, fixtures, and even the ceiling, there are a thousand possibilities to use black without risking monotony.
Whether you want to use this shade on the wall or elsewhere, the results will always be different depending on the room, light, and color combinations.
Whatever style you want to give your space, whether contemporary, Scandinavian, vintage, or minimalist, black is always an excellent ally for decoration.

However, it is important to ensure you have enough light and illumination before being generous with black.
If this is not the case, choose only black fixtures on an all-white ensemble.
Using black grout on white tiles or earthenware creates a very pleasant graphic and contrasting effect, without darkening the space.
Bet on wood, for example, on the vanity unit, to bring some warmth to your room.
